#071392 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#071392 is composed of 2.7% red, 7.5%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.2% cyan, 87%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 234.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 30%. #071392 color hex could be obtained by blending #0e26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#071392 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#071392 has RGB values of R:7, G:19,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 463762.

Shades and Tints of #071392
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01020f is the darkest color, while #fbf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#071392
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484951 is the less saturated color, while #010e98 is the most saturated one.
